Tbf their rationale for nuclear war makes sense in the full context. They recognize it's an awful thing but they believe it's inevitable under the capitalist world order as we always need to consume and use more which will inevitably lead to conflicts over resources. Due to this believed inevitability they believe that the socialist world should instead be the ones to instigate it so that they're prepared and civilization has a better chance of surviving the exchange.
From a strictly dialectical materialist viewpoint it makes sense. Same thing with the communist extraterrestials, because according to the dialectical materialism and marxist ideology they would have necessarily been reached the state of communism TM by the time they have interstellar spaceflight or whatever.
